Why It's Important to Replace Your CPAP Mask

Your mask serves as the link between your machine and your body. If it’s not fitting snugly or has seen better days, it can impact:

  • Therapy effectiveness: Air leaks reduce the pressure needed to keep your airway open.
  • Sleep quality: Frequent adjustments or discomfort can wake you up.
  • Comfort and hygiene: Old cushions can collect tons of bacteria and oils, causing irritation or breakouts.

Just like anything else, your mask will start to develop some wear and tear as the materials in your mask break down from daily use, skin oils, and cleaning. Regularly replacing it ensures that your therapy remains effective, comfortable, and hygienic!

5 Signs It’s Time to Replace Your CPAP Mask

1. You’re Noticing More Air Leaks

If you’re constantly tightening your headgear or adjusting your mask to stop leaks, that’s a sign the cushion or straps may have worn out. A loose or misshapen mask can cause:

  • A whistling or hissing sound while you sleep
  • Reduced airflow and poor therapy results
  • Waking up with a dry mouth or feeling unrested

2. The Cushion Looks or Feels Worn

Your cushion (or nasal pillows) is the part of the mask that sits directly on your face, and it wears out faster than the frame or headgear. Watch for:

  • Cracks or tears in the cushion
  • A sticky or tacky texture
  • Discoloration or yellowing

3. Your Mask Doesn’t Fit Like It Used To

If your mask feels loose or doesn’t stay in place, the headgear straps may have stretched out over time. This can lead to:

  • A poor seal (even when the mask is tightened)
  • More noticeable strap marks on your face
  • A general feeling that the mask just doesn’t sit “right” anymore

4. You’re Waking Up Feeling Tired Again

When your CPAP mask isn’t working properly, your sleep therapy might not be as effective. If you’re starting to notice:

  • Daytime fatigue creeping back
  • Morning headaches
  • Snoring despite using your CPAP machine

…it’s worth checking whether your mask is due for replacement!

5. You Can’t Remember the Last Time You Replaced It

If you’ve had the same mask for several months, or longer, it’s probably time.

  • Mask frames should be replaced every 3 months, while headgear should be replaced every 6 months.
  • Cushions and pillows should be replaced monthly (especially important if you notice wear and tear).
